Baja California Trip
Hi guys,
Anyone else going to be around in Baja California (Los Cabos/East Cape) 28 February to 12 March?
I've got 3 nights (2 days Super Panga) at Rancho Leonero (East Cape); 4 nights (2 days Super Panga) at Punta Colorado (East Cape); 3 nights at La Playita, East of San Jose del Cabo (2 days Super Panga), and 3 nights in Central Cabo San Lucas (fishing still to be booked).
I know it's a little "off-season", but there should still be some decent fish around (providing the wind isn't too strong) and the Moon is good with a New Moon on the 7 March.

Ullo matey
Looks like a pretty good itinerary to me. I see from the Cabomagic daily catch reports that stripies are still being taken from Cabo, but only by the big cruisers on full-day charters, so presumably they're a long way off. The pangas inshore seem to be taking mostly sierra mackerel and the odd wahoo.
I was at Rancho Leonero in Nov (there's a report in this forum), and it's a great place for anglers. Send me a PM if you need to know more, and pass my regards to Gary Barnes-Webb, the RL manager.
